Sha256: e61043b28fd0af851998518558846e6941f4ddbfa865fcedf5c4d9ab5aec24af

Contents?: true

Size: 240 Bytes

Versions: 3

Compression:

Stored size: 240 Bytes

Contents

require 'test_helper'

class Workhorse::PollerTest < WorkhorseTest
  def test_interruptable_sleep
    w = Workhorse::Worker.new(polling_interval: 60)
    w.start
    sleep 0.5

    Timeout.timeout(1.5) do
      w.shutdown
    end
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
workhorse-0.2.0 test/workhorse/poller_test.rb
workhorse-0.1.0 test/workhorse/poller_test.rb
workhorse-0.0.3 test/workhorse/poller_test.rb